Chopped Green Salad with Macadamia Nut Oil
I hesitate to call any food my favorite, but I could eat this salad all day, every day. It’s dressed with Macadamia nut oil and fresh lemon juice which allows the raw flavors of the other ingredients to shine through. The sautéed and seasoned almonds add just the right amount of additional flavor. This salad is fresh and crunchy and oh so good! You will love it. Enjoy!
Ingredients:
2 teaspoons olive oil
⅔ cup raw slivered almonds
¼ teaspoon sea salt
1 teaspoon cumin
3 cups chopped kale
3 cups chopped spinach
1 avocado
2 cups broccoli florets
¼ cup hemp seeds
Macadamia Nut oil, about 2 Tablespoons
1 lemon
Sea salt
Black pepper
Directions:
- Place olive oil in a small sauté pan over medium heat.
- Add almonds and begin to toast, stirring frequently.
- Sauté until golden adding salt and cumin when almost done.
- Set almonds aside.
- Place kale and spinach in a salad bowl.
- Dice avocado and add to bowl.
- Cut broccoli florets into small pieces and add to bowl.
- Add toasted almonds and hemp seeds.
- Drizzle macadamia nut oil over the salad.
- Cut lemon in half and squeeze the juice from both halves over the salad.
- Toss salad and season with salt and pepper to taste
